NetServerEnum2 and looking for dc

Rafal Szczesniak mimir at diament.ists.pwr.wroc.pl
Mon Feb 11 00:17:05 GMT 2002


On Sun, 10 Feb 2002, Jim McDonough wrote:

> Rafal Szczesniak wrote:
> >While working on trusted domains, I've noticed that cli_get_pdc_name
> >function (libsmb/clirap2.c) using NetServerEnum2 call looks only for
> >Primary Domain Controller and not for Backup Domain Controller.
> >
> >Is it on purpose or just forgotten ?
> Well, ahem, umm, well, uhhh....
> 
> This is a function that never gets called...er...ummm

Now it gets once :)

> The best explanation I can give is: it was for some other work we were
> doing, didn't finish, but I don't quite remember what it was anymore.
> 
> That aside, since it's "cli_get_pdc_name", I'd say it was intentionally
> only looking for a PDC.  If you'd like to modify it to look for PDCs and
> BDCs,  have fun!  Otherwise we should probably remove it.

No, if Samba is supposed to behave exactly like WinNT Server when
establishing trust, then it should stay. cli_get_pdc_name is used already
once and, as I see, for the first time :-)

Anyway, I'll modify it to look for BDCs also.


cheers,
+------------------------------------------------------------+
|Rafal 'Mimir' Szczesniak <mimir at diament.ists.pwr.wroc.pl>   |
|*BSD, GNU/Linux and Samba                                  /
|__________________________________________________________/





More information about the samba-technical mailing list